Baldur's Gate 3 Clinches Game of the Year at BAFTA

Baldur’s Gate 3 continues its triumph across major gaming events, clinching the prestigious Game of the Year title at the BAFTA Awards. This victory marks a historic moment as it becomes the first game to sweep the top awards at all key industry events, including The Game Awards, Golden Joystick, DICE, and GDC.

In addition to the top honor, Baldur’s Gate 3 also won accolades for Best Game Music, Best Supporting Role, and Best Narrative at the BAFTA. The game, developed by Larian Studios, has set a new benchmark in the CRPG genre, captivating players with its depth and complex gameplay.

Celebrations are abundant within Larian Studios as Swen Vincke, the CEO, expressed his disbelief and gratitude for the recognition. “I still can’t believe we’re standing here. This is amazing. Thank you, everyone,” Vincke shared during the awards ceremony.

The success of Baldur’s Gate 3 is not just a testament to its quality but also to the innovative spirit of Larian Studios. As the studio looks to the future, they aim to push the boundaries of RPGs even further.

The game has not only dominated awards but also received critical acclaim for its engaging gameplay and rich storytelling, setting a new standard for what players can expect from the genre. As Baldur’s Gate 3 continues to make waves, it remains a significant title that will be remembered for years to come.
